US’s Ukraine Gambit: Not About Kiev, But Russia and China
Trump's stance on arming Ukraine isn't about helping Kiev — it’s a move to weaken Russia and disrupt the Russian-Chinese alliance threatening US global dominance, political scientist Gerard Deeb told Sputnik.
His rhetoric may be “political blackmail,” but his actions risk being reckless.
Trump wants Europe to pay for weapons while continuing the war, not pushing for peace, the expert noted.
The goal? Prolong the conflict, drain Russian resources, and distract from Taiwan.
Thus, it’s part of a broader strategy to contain China via proxy conflicts.
“Russia holds strong cards” — and without serious diplomacy, may choose a military path to settle the conflict on its terms, Deeb concluded.
